Police seek robber who struck in Windsor Terrace

Cops are hunting for a robber who struck in Windsor Terrace, knocking down his victim before taking off with her possessions.

According to police, it was 8:25 a.m. on Friday, May 26 when the 23-year-old female was robbed in front of 310 Vanderbilt Avenue.

According to cops, the thief approached the woman from behind and elbowed the left side of her face before shoving her to the ground. He then ran off on foot with the woman’s purse and cellphone, eventually dropping the purse as he fled.

Police describe the suspect as a black man between 20-25 years of age with braided hair, last seen wearing a dark colored shirt and dark jeans.

The victim was treated at NYU Lutheran Medical Center for her injury.
